Instagram hits 150 million monthly users, Ads are coming to the platform with in a year

Instagram has reached 150 million monthly users milestone, it announced on its blog. The number of users rose nearly 100 million since its acquisition a year ago by Facebook. Instagram has got 50 million users in the last six months. Growth is good and but unless you have a way to monetize these users the numbers mean nothing. Facebook has hinted at monetizing Instagram at some point. Today WSJ reports that Instagram will serve ads with in the next year.

Emily White, Instagram’s director business operations told WSJ that Instagram should be ready to begin selling ads within the next year. Her first challenge is now to introduce ads without effecting user experience. Currently Instagram has no ads, initially Instagram doesn’t have a web interface, it was introduced later.

It is not clear what type of ads will pop up there and where, but White tells WSJ that they are looking at Instagram’s discover feature and search feature as of now. She also told that some retailers want product pictures on the network should link to the products on their websites.
